Гость
Целевая тема:
Создать новую тему:
Автор:
Форумы / Microsoft Office [игнор отключен] [закрыт для гостей] / Копирование+ упорядочивание данных / 9 сообщений из 9, страница 1 из 1
21.08.2007, 16:31:46
    #34742305
Evrodiller
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Копирование+ упорядочивание данных
Вот столкнулся с такой задачей.
Есть файл (верхний рисунок) из него нужно скопировать данные и вставить в Лист1 в виде который предоставлен на рисунке нижнем. Возможно ли такое? Никаких дополнительных столбцов в исходной таблице делать нельзя :(
...
Рейтинг: 0 / 0
21.08.2007, 17:26:43
    #34742601
big-duke
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Копирование+ упорядочивание данных
частично можно транспонированием при вставке. а лучше приложите сам файл , а не скрин.
...
Рейтинг: 0 / 0
21.08.2007, 17:31:50
    #34742627
Deggasad
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Копирование+ упорядочивание данных
big-dukeчастично можно транспонированием при вставке. а лучше приложите сам файл , а не скрин.

Да точно -файл в студию
...
Рейтинг: 0 / 0
21.08.2007, 18:15:52
    #34742814
Deggasad
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Копирование+ упорядочивание данных
Смотри вот с пол года назад кому-то помогал, только код немного поправить нужно будет
...
Рейтинг: 0 / 0
22.08.2007, 14:16:43
    #34744850
Evrodiller
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Копирование+ упорядочивание данных
Deggasad
На первый взгляд самое оно, попробую разобраться, спасиб :)
...
Рейтинг: 0 / 0
23.08.2007, 10:29:47
    #34746659
Evrodiller
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Копирование+ упорядочивание данных
Попробывал сделать, но немного не получается, буду благодарен за разъеснение.

Хотелось бы добавить возможность записи результатов в таблицу последовательно, на листе "e" в файле показан пример.
...
Рейтинг: 0 / 0
23.08.2007, 11:34:32
    #34746984
Deggasad
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Копирование+ упорядочивание данных
Смотри файл
...
Рейтинг: 0 / 0
23.08.2007, 11:37:04
    #34746998
Evrodiller
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Копирование+ упорядочивание данных
DeggasadСмотри файл
Спасибо, большое
...
Рейтинг: 0 / 0
23.08.2007, 15:45:12
    #34748295
Deggasad
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Копирование+ упорядочивание данных
Поправил немного, а то там кое-что совсем глупо было.

Код: plaintext
1.
2.
3.
4.
5.
6.
7.
8.
9.
10.
11.
12.
13.
14.
15.
16.
17.
18.
19.
20.
21.
22.
23.
24.
25.
26.
27.
28.
29.
30.
31.
32.
33.
34.
35.
36.
37.
38.
39.
Sub ll_f_sad()
 Dim SVOD As Worksheet
 Dim ws As Worksheet
 Dim numExist As Boolean
 Dim myRng As Range
 Dim FirstRow As Integer
 Dim LastRow As Integer
 
 Set SVOD = Worksheets("e")

 For Each ws In ThisWorkbook.Worksheets
  If ws.Name <> SVOD.Name Then
    
    'Проверка уже скопированных накладных
    On Error Resume Next
      numExist = False
      numExist = IsNumeric(SVOD.Range("A:A").Find(ws.Range("f2").Value).Row)
    On Error GoTo  0 
    
    If numExist = False Then
      Set myRange = ws.Range("A11", ws.Range("D" & ws.Rows.Count).End(xlUp))
      FirstRow = SVOD.Range("A" & SVOD.Rows.Count).End(xlUp).Offset( 1 ,  0 ).Row
      LastRow = FirstRow -  1  + myRange.Rows.Count
      
      SVOD.Range("A" & FirstRow, "A" & LastRow).Value = ws.Range("F2").Value
      SVOD.Range("B" & FirstRow, "B" & LastRow).Value = ws.Range("H2").Value
      SVOD.Range("C" & FirstRow, "C" & LastRow).Value = ws.Range("C3").Value
      SVOD.Range("D" & FirstRow, "D" & LastRow).Value = myRange.Columns( 1 ).Value
      SVOD.Range("E" & FirstRow, "E" & LastRow).Value = myRange.Columns( 3 ).Value
      SVOD.Range("F" & FirstRow, "F" & LastRow).Value = myRange.Columns( 4 ).Value
    End If
  
  End If

 Next ws

 SVOD.Select
 Range("A1").Select

End Sub
...
Рейтинг: 0 / 0
Форумы / Microsoft Office [игнор отключен] [закрыт для гостей] / Копирование+ упорядочивание данных / 9 сообщений из 9, страница 1 из 1
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]